Abstract: Although histopathology remains the current gold standard for the diagnosis of basal cell carcinoma (BCC), reflectance confocal microscopy (RCM) represents an optimal imaging tool for noninvasive diagnosis and for the monitoring of nonsurgical therapy of BCC, such as photodynamic therapy (PDT), cryosurgery, imiquimod cream, and oral hedgehog inhibitors (HHIs). © 2017 by Taylor and Francis Group, LLC.
